When I was in my 20's and 30's, before I ever owned a store, I would make a list of the items I wanted for Spring and for Fall. Sometimes it was quite specific...like "Ralph Lauren floral tapestry blazer" and other times, it was a general item, such as "new boots".

I had a palette in mind and then everything I accumulated fit in with that. I would carefully hang my new items at the front of my closet, vowing not to wear any of them until fall. This brought back memories of buying new clothes for the beginning of school in September, when I could hardly wait to wear my new clothes to see my friends again.

I love clothing. It makes a difference in my life and makes me feel comfortable in a world that can be chaotic and challenging at times. Clothing brings consistency and fun to every day activities. It is probably why I became a clothing designer and boutique owner, no? lol

Since I have owned my shop (1995) my bi-yearly wish list of wardrobe additions has focused more on what I want to have in the shop. Of course, I still have wish lists and this fall is no exception. Many of the items I want to gather have already been collected....including several of my exclusive maxi dress design like the plaid one shown above. I really would love to have a plain black maxi dress so that will be made soon. My colours rarely expand beyond blacks and greys so I make things different by changing textures and silhouettes.
